Authorities have charged a man in the fatal shooting a South Carolina police officer during a traffic stop over the weekend.
5 min readA 26-year-old police officer was gunned down on Sunday, marking the first law enforcement officer killed in the line of duty in the United States in 2020, authorities said.James Edward Bell, 37, was charged with murder, discharging of a firearm into a vehicle and possession of a weapon during a violent crime on Monday, one day after he allegedly shot and killed an airport police officer.
Winkeler was found dead on the ground outside of his police vehicle. His weapon was missing, but police found an empty 9 mm handgun and more than 30 shell casings nearby, according to an arrest affidavit.
